General Description
The LM221 series are precision preamplifiers designed to
operate with general purpose operational amplifiers to drastically decrease dc errors. Drift, bias current, common mode
and supply rejection are more than a factor of 50 better than
standard op amps alone. Further, the added dc gain of the
LM221 decreases the closed loop gain error.
The LM221 series operates with supply voltages from g3V
to g20V and has sufficient supply rejection to operate from
unregulated supplies. The operating current is programmable from 5 mA to 200 mA so bias current, offset current, gain
and noise can be optimized for the particular application
while still realizing very low drift. Super-gain transistors are
used for the input stage so input error currents are lower
than conventional amplifiers at the same operating current.
Further, the initial offset voltage is easily nulled to zero.
The extremely low drift of the LM221 will improve accuracy
on almost any precision dc circuit. For example, instrumentation amplifier, strain gauge amplifiers and thermocouple
amplifiers now using chopper amplifiers can be made with
the LM221. The full differential input and high commonmode rejection are another advantage over choppers. For
applications where low bias current is more important than
drift, the operating current can be reduced to low values.
High operating currents can be used for low voltage noise
with low source resistance. The programmable operating
current of the LM221 allows tailoring the input characteristics to match those of specialized op amps.
The LM221 is specified over a b25§C to a85§C range and
the LM321 over a 0§C to a70§C temperature range.
Features
- Guaranteed drift of LM321AÐ0.2 mV/§C
- Guaranteed drift of LM221 seriesÐ1 mV/§C
- Offset voltage less than 0.4 mV
- Bias current less than 10 nA at 10 mA operating current
- CMRR 126 dB minimum
- 120 dB supply rejection
- Easily nulled offset voltage
